What is Chip Board?
Chip board is a thick, rigid paperboard made from recycled paper materials. It is known for its sturdiness and eco-friendliness, making it a preferred material for various industries. The board is available in different thickness levels, typically ranging from 1mm to 4mm, and GSM levels from 660 to 2640, providing strength and durability for various packaging needs.
Unlike plastic and other non-recyclable materials, this board is biodegradable and recyclable, making it an environmentally responsible choice.
The Eco-Friendly Advantages of Chip Board
Made from 100% Recycled Materials
One of the biggest reasons it is considered eco-friendly is that it is produced entirely from recycled paper. This significantly reduces the need for virgin materials and minimizes deforestation, contributing to a more sustainable environment.
Biodegradable and Recyclable
Unlike plastic packaging, which takes centuries to decompose, it is biodegradable. It can also be recycled multiple times, reducing waste in landfills and promoting a circular economy.
Energy-Efficient Manufacturing Process
The production of the board requires less energy compared to plastic and metal packaging. Since it is made from recycled fibers, the manufacturing process consumes fewer natural resources, leading to a lower carbon footprint.
Reduction in Packaging Waste
Since this board is durable and customizable, businesses can optimize packaging designs to minimize excess material usage. This results in reduced packaging waste and more efficient shipping and storage solutions.
Safe for Food and Consumer Goods
Unlike certain plastic packaging that may contain harmful chemicals, the board is safe for packaging food, cosmetics, and other consumer goods. Many manufacturers offer food-grade chip board, ensuring product safety without compromising environmental sustainability.
Applications of Chip Board in Packaging
Product Packaging
the board is commonly used for packaging high-value products such as electronics, glass materials, and jewelry boxes. Its rigid structure provides excellent protection against external impacts.
Book Binding and Stationery
Due to its durability and smooth surface, this board is an ideal material for bookbinding covers, hardcover albums, and hard files. These applications ensure long-term protection and a premium feel.
Retail and Custom Packaging
Many retail businesses prefer chip_board for its ability to create sturdy, high-quality packaging. Custom packaging solutions made from this board enhance brand presentation while maintaining sustainability.
Eco-Friendly Gift Boxes
Luxury and eco-conscious brands use chip board for high-end gift boxes. It offers a premium look while remaining environmentally friendly.
Protective Inserts and Dividers
For products that require extra protection, it is used to create inserts and dividers inside packaging. This prevents items from shifting during transport, reducing damage and returns.

Choosing the Right Chip Board for Your Needs
Thickness & Strength
It comes in different thickness levels ranging from 1mm to 4mm. Choosing the right thickness depends on the level of protection required for the product.
GSM Levels
With GSM ranging from 660 to 2640, businesses can select the appropriate density based on their packaging needs. Higher GSM ensures more rigidity and strength.
Standard & Custom Sizes
While the board is available in standard sizes, custom sizes can be manufactured to meet specific requirements. This ensures maximum efficiency and reduces waste.
